kristianng:But one problem... Some resellers are very old in this business so no matter the price they fixed they have loyal customers that will always buy from them, What about those who are new to the business? How would they attract customers when everybody have the same price? Those old resellers did exactly the same thing when they started...They reduce their price(and make promos) to attract customers and after attracting a lots of loyal customers they now have a fixed price. This data reselling business is big enough to accommodate everybody! Any data resellers can be swift, fast, trusted and reliable. The only difference between them is their price. Some of them are ok with little profits so they sell cheaply, others want only large profit. Everybody needs is different. As long as they are not occupying anybody spaces why blame them? The number of resellers is not limited...If they all agree on a fixed price and some resellers have more customers won't the others feel cheated? Besides no matter the price MTN will still do this. They will always try to blocked anything that is a threat to their business. The data resellers plan is way better than any MTN plan. Imagine MTN selling 200mb for 1k and 150mb for N500 only for a week.Even a data reseller selling 1gb for N1500 is still better than any MTN plan. We should stop this blame game, MTN would still block it regardless the price. 6 Likes |

Idrismusty97: I believe the so-called "old resellers" introduced some, if not, most of the newbies into the business. So their way of saying thank you for introducing em into the "milky&honey" business is to target their customers by advertsing their data plans at almost zero-profit prices? And you think the old reseller will keep mum and watch them redirect his customers to themselves... These brought all these unnecessary price reduction... Let me tell you, i have about 50GB stuck, but if i were MTN, i would do the same. We abused the service, believe me! We made it look like we own it. LOOL! Take airtime distributors for example, Go to Mr A in Calabar and Mr B in Lagos... They all distribute to their sub-delears at the same rate and are making their money! Did you know NCC is the reason why voice calls are not cheaper? They regulated it when they noticed anti-competitive prices among our carriers... If not, who knows by now, we would've been making national calls at 2NGN per minute. Yes! We would all like to make calls at such rate, but will this keep the service alive? Let's sit back and devise the best way to target customers and not making that SME data appear too common.... That's if MTN will relent on this their harsh term and restore it since they claimed it's an error. LOL!
